Such natural conditions are tonghua wine's unique secret. Water quantity has an important influence on the sugar and tannin content of grapes. The annual precipitation in Tonghua has been kept at about 635~679mm, which is suitable for the accumulation of glucose and tannin, and will not affect the taste of wine because of too much or too little sugar.
